Transaction 6865206ccd7f2f4a8db559881bc93404577052aaac2b5b9e20c8b1099c44b61b
1 Input
1 Output
-
6865206ccd7f2f4a8db559881bc93404577052aaac2b5b9e20c8b1099c44b61b:0
- value
- 4999564
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 badd3c2657a0e4fca9634ca0280775174e53159e270d3cc2c6eb8528a1814386
- address
- bc1phtwncfjh5rj0e2trfjszspm4za89x9v7yuxneskxawzj3gvpgwrq9j9xdz